Over the weekend, a dog known to Henderson County Animal Services as aggressive attacked a woman in the River Oaks community. According to WLOS ABC News Channel 13, the owners previously surrendered the dog after it mauled a smaller dog last year. The owners later re-adopted the dog, after they were given notice that it was going to be euthanized. They were required to follow strict safety guidelines, since the dog had a history of aggression.

Unfortunately, the dog reportedly got loose and attacked a woman who lives in the community. She suffered injuries to her arm, back and other parts of her body. The owners are facing two misdemeanors and a $500 fine. Officials with Henderson County Animal Services are considering a change to their current policy after this event.
